Output 43fa86887ef9805a724b59721d58896a02722398a94f110f542e4c870b2552f9:1

value
7679773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f758d35b27d78e7bfabff42787452235998940f2 OP_EQUAL
address
3QEsEdvYvnfZ5rtjJ2TnXoALZQcYhGKwFH
transaction
43fa86887ef9805a724b59721d58896a02722398a94f110f542e4c870b2552f9
spent
true